Top AI Code Editors

AI-powered code editors have evolved from simple rules-based autocomplete tools into intelligent software engineering platforms that actively play a role in creating and managing code. While approaches differ, most leading tools bring together three core components:

  • The workspace: A visual editing interface that replaces or builds on top of an integrated development environment (IDE)

  • The reasoning layer: A coding assistant powered by one or more large language models (LLMs) that understands natural language, answers questions about the codebase, generates code and recommends improvements

  • The execution layer: One or more AI agents directed by the coding assistant to perform autonomous, multi-step tasks on the developer’s behalf

Common features cover every aspect of software development: Planning, code generation, code review, test generation, debugging, deployment and governance.

The editors in this list are sometimes referred to as code assistants, coding agents, AI-first coding platforms, or coding partners. Readers should understand that delineations between these categories are increasingly blurry and even meaningless in some cases. The AI coding market is converging, with most major products adding similar core capabilities. As a result, it’s difficult to say, for instance, whether a specific editor is an assistant or an agent. Most of the products featured here lie on a spectrum. The meaningful differences lie in what they optimize for. For example, some are better for individual coders working on an isolated passion project. Others are more capable of handling robust enterprise-grade workflows.

The following editors are grouped into two broad categories: Code editors and AI agents/assistants that work on top of an existing IDE. Some tools prioritize governance and security in an enterprise context, while others focus on rapid prototyping or cloud-native development. The right choice for a given project depends on a number of factors, such as the developers’ workflow, preferred programming languages, existing toolchain, deployment requirements and the desired level of autonomy vs. control.

AI code editors

These are editors or IDEs built with AI as a core part of the experience. AI is integrated throughout the development workflow and not as an afterthought. These platforms are suitable for use as a developer’s primary coding environment. Other tools may live on top of an IDE—these ones bring their own environment to the table.

Visual Studio Code (with extensions)

Visual Studio Code, or VS code, is the veteran of the list, and it remains one of the most widely used code editors despite its age. Microsoft’s continued investment in AI has transformed it into a capable AI-assisted development environment (with the right extensions). This is especially helpful for seasoned developers who already know the platform intimately.

VS Code offers granular control and security. Native VS Code allows one to use local LLMs or route traffic through secure enterprise proxies.

Cursor

Cursor is a VS Code fork, which means it uses the same core open-source codebase. It retains the same features, layouts and keyboard shortcuts—again, a benefit to those used to VS Code’s interface. But the key differentiator that Cursor brings is that AI is integrated natively. Cursor is designed for AI-driven coding, but in an established environment that developers already know well. Developers might choose Cursor because it doesn’t rely on AI extensions—the AI is baked in.

Zed

Zed emphasizes speed, responsiveness and collaboration. This might appeal to fans of lightweight editors like Neovim. Unlike JavaScript or TypeScript-based Electron editors, Zed offers native performance while incorporating AI-assisted development into a lightweight, open-source editing experience. Zed also uses a custom, GPU-accelerated UI framework instead of Electron-based alternatives.

Replit

Replit is a cloud-native development environment that combines an online IDE, managed runtime and AI tools. Unlike desktop code editors, Replit enables users to not just write, but run, test and deploy applications entirely from the browser.

Replit also has powerful agentic features. Replit Agent can scaffold entire applications, implement features across files, write SQL queries, diagnose bugs and iteratively refine projects based on natural language instructions.

Because it all works within Replit’s managed cloud environment, developers don’t have to concern themselves with local infrastructure. This speed and simplicity make it attractive for rapid prototyping, education and startups.

AI coding assistants and agents

These products extend the functionality of an existing IDE rather than replacing it entirely. They offer powerful conversational assistance, code generation and explanation, enterprise integrations and governance.

GitHub Copilot

GitHub Copilot is a widely deployed AI coding tool inside large organizations. Originally known for its role as an AI-powered code completion tool and AI code generator, it has evolved into a comprehensive AI development platform that supports agentic coding with Copilot Chat, among other AI-powered features.

Organizations already using GitHub benefit from AI capabilities throughout the software development lifecycle (SDLC).

JetBrains AI Assistant

JetBrains AI Assistant enhances the IntelliJ family of IDEs by combining AI with the company’s mature language intelligence. Rather than replacing static analysis and sophisticated refactoring tools, AI builds on them to provide smarter code generation, explanations and project-aware assistance.

Developers working primarily in programming languages such as Java, Kotlin, C# and Python often prefer JetBrains tools like PyCharm for its language-specific tooling.

Gemini Code Assist

Google Gemini Code Assist is Google’s enterprise AI coding assistant, built on the Gemini family of foundation models. Gemini Code Assist is a strong choice for organizations building on Google Cloud or developing Android apps. Its primary differentiator is Google’s expertise in large-context reasoning and cloud-native development, with deep integrations across Google Cloud, Firebase and Android Studio.

Amazon Q Developer

Amazon Q Developer specializes in cloud-native software development. It supports general programming tasks, but its greatest strengths are AWS architecture, infrastructure-as-code, cloud security and application modernization.

Teams heavily invested in AWS gain an AI assistant that understands cloud services, infrastructure patterns and AWS best practices better than other coding assistants.

Claude Code

Claude Code takes a different approach by operating primarily from the command line instead of replacing a traditional IDE. Claude Code excels in deeper context handling, multi-file edits and first-party integration with Anthropic’s models.

Claude Code was developed by Anthropic, so its system prompt and tool-use architecture are natively optimized for Claude’s models.

OpenAI Codex

OpenAI’s Codex has evolved from a coding assistant into a full-fledged AI software engineering platform. Its core differentiator is an emphasis on delegation: developers can assign projects to one or more autonomous agents while they do other work.

Cline

Cline is one of the most capable open-source AI coding agents. Running as a Visual Studio Code extension, it gives developers complete control over model selection while providing autonomous coding capabilities comparable to many commercial offerings.

Cline is ideal for developers who value transparency, extensibility and the ability to switch freely among AI providers without vendor lock-in.

Devin Desktop

Codeium’s Windsurf was acquired by Cognition, the same company behind the AI software engineer Devin. It now combines them into a desktop development environment to create a command center for managing agents via a Kanban view.
